WebNov 18, 2024 · Yes, guinea pigs can eat lemons but in moderation. Lemons have high acidic properties, and so ingestion of excess lemons might lead to severe adverse effects. Some of these negative effects include stomach upsets, teeth sensitivity, and urinary complications. A lemon, like any citrus fruit, offers an abundance of vitamin C. WebJan 1, 2014 · Can guinea pigs have lemon juice? The thing with it is it is also way too acidic for guinea pigs to drink. If they do drink it, like us, they will get serious tummy trouble. Guinea pigs should only drink water and don’t have the ability to take in other types of liquids. Even lemon cordial or lemon squash is not good for them. WebLemon side effects in guinea pigs.
